this thing has got me hooked :O ive always been so in love with 2 strokes and i gotta get myself a rz350 bottom end for this would be a sick project any1 know if the rz250 and rz350 use the same bottom end?
Yes, RZ250/350 bottom ends are the same; except some early 1983 RZ250 engines used LC cranks, which have 1mm narrower big ends/ a narrower crank overall. Still, these cases can be machined to accept the wider YPVS crank. These RZ250 engines with LC cranks also ran LC flywheels/stators. The stator stud pattern is different from LC to YPVS; however you can interchange the stator mounting plates. 2T oil pump/worm drive shaft differs from 250 to 350. Banshee cases are the same as YPVS too.
